Que diferencia hay entre una variable puntero y una variable referencia?
Tabla de contenido
¿Qué diferencia hay entre una variable puntero y una variable referencia?
Un puntero puede ser re-asigando cualquier numero de veces mientras una referencia solo puede ser asignada al momento de la creación. Punteros pueden apuntar a “ninguna parte” ( NULL, nullptr ), mientras que referencias simpre apuntan (o hacen referencia) a un objeto.
¿Qué significa una flecha y una C?
Un operador de Flecha en C / C++ permite acceder a elementos en Estructuras y Uniones . Se utiliza con una variable de puntero que apunta a una estructura o unión .
¿Cómo se utilizan los apuntadores?
Los apuntadores se utilizan para dar claridad y simplicidad a las operaciones a nivel de memoria. Lenguaje C es un lenguaje de alto nivel porque permite programar a bajo nivel.
¿Qué significa una flecha en C++?
De forma análoga, el operador flecha (->) se utiliza cuando se dispone de la dirección de un objeto (en el puntero correspondiente), en lugar del nombre del objeto. Como se verá más adelante, en C++ es mucho más habitual utilizar el operador flecha que el operador punto.
¿Cuál es el significado de la palabra puntero?
Según el Diccionario inglés de Oxford, la palabra puntero apareció impresa por primera vez como un puntero de pila en un memorando técnico de la System Development Corporation (Corporación de Desarrollo de Sistemas).
¿Cuál es la diferencia entre un puntero y una referencia?
La principal diferencia entre el puntero y la referencia es que el puntero es una variable que contiene la dirección de otra variable, mientras que la referencia es un alias para acceder a una variable ya existente. 1. «Punteros C». Cadenas de Python (con ejemplos),
¿Cómo puedo asignar un puntero a otro?
Un puntero puede ser asignado a otro si son del mismo tipo. Si son de tipos distintos hay que usar un operador de conversión (cast) salvo que uno de ellos sea un puntero void. Todos los tipos de punteros pueden ser asignados a un puntero void y un puntero void puede asignarse a cualquier tipo de puntero.
¿Cuál es la función de los punteros en Pauscal?
Pauscal utiliza los punteros para convertir tipos de datos sin necesidad de ninguna interfaz de programación de aplicaciones (API) externa, aumentando la velocidad de ejecución de los programas ligeramente y permitiendo que estos sean «nativos» del lenguaje.